Transaction 7bab21f833a127215f3f1e6dbd1692e5a763aae18f1479ff8c31e438402ec8ed

1 Input
2 Outputs
  • 7bab21f833a127215f3f1e6dbd1692e5a763aae18f1479ff8c31e438402ec8ed:0
  • value  58552129
    address  1CFPYHCcv7FQoTvg7M6xUiD8nvVJ6jEmbN
  • 7bab21f833a127215f3f1e6dbd1692e5a763aae18f1479ff8c31e438402ec8ed:1
  • value  41259961
    address  16egDQAgwmrZqNYZcn3akBRUSywVSyVadw